Substantivbestandteile, often translated as noun components or noun adjuncts in English, are elements within a compound noun that are themselves nouns. These components function to modify or specify the meaning of the main noun, which is typically the last part of the compound. For example, in the German word "Haustür" (house door), "Haus" (house) is the substantivbestandteil modifying "Tür" (door). The substantivbestandteil provides additional information about the type, purpose, or origin of the main noun.
